Abstract :
Migration of courses constituting higher engineering education to into an OBE (Outcome Based Education) environment is a challenging activity and varied perspectives. Such migration involves graceful modulation to the curriculum, delivery mechanisms and the assessment criteria. These modulations are driven by modulated Course Outcomes which, invariably, lands up, asynchronously, with, apparently, different motivations. A process frame work is believed to alleviate the difficulties in achieving successful migration and hence is formalized in this paper and presented. A case study of migration process which has been implemented by the authors for an UG (Under Graduate) programme course titled “Wireless Communication” is presented. The potential of simulation tool in accomplishing successful OBE is, incidentally, discovered and owing to their importance, otherwise, the importance of the development of skill set in the use of simulation tools with a clear understanding of the domain as an effective mechanism to achieve OBE is emphasized.
